It's Saturday night and Andy collapses on the couch after turning on Mya's newest obsession- Frozen. Andy and Sam have seen it so many times that they could likely recite it from memory. But she just gets so excited when it comes on that they don't have the heart to suggest a different movie.

Andy maneuvers around a little bit, trying to get situated on the couch. With her seven month pregnant belly, it takes a second to get comfortable nowadays.

"Hm… I wonder what we're watching," Sam says with a smirk as he walks into the room.

"Frozen, Daddy!" Mya declares with a big grin. She's sitting cross-legged on the rug, clutching her Elsa doll as the movie begins.

"What else?" Andy quips as Sam sits down beside her. He pulls her close to him and rests his hand right on her belly. She tilts her head to look up at her husband and they exchange a smile before she leans in to give him a kiss.

Ever since she told him that she was pregnant, he's been different. It was almost instantaneous, actually. He started driving differently- way more careful and never going over the speed limit. He started doting on her- always making sure she eats and isn't working too hard. He started helping her in and out of the truck- even before she actually needed the help. He started rubbing her feet a lot- even before they were swollen and sore. And he started touching her stomach pretty much all the time- even before she had a bump.

Sometimes she finds it a little annoying- the hovering and the worrying and the always asking her if she's eaten. But most of the time, she thinks it's incredibly sweet and adorable and she absolutely loves it.

Even if he didn't tell her all the time, she can tell how excited he is and it just makes her even more excited.

"Love you," she tells him quietly as her lips hover over his.

"Love you, too," he says before pressing his lips against hers again.

"Daddy, turn it up!" Mya exclaims.

Sam and Andy let out a laugh before Sam pulls away and grabs the remote from the side table. As he starts pressing buttons, Andy lets out a gasp.

"You okay?" He asks, turning to face her with a concerned look on his face. "What's wrong?" He asks.

She doesn't say anything. Instead, she grabs his hand, places it on the side of her stomach and just watches his face. Then he feels it. Kicking.

"Oh… Oh wow, she's really kicking," he observes with a grin.

"I know!" She squeals.

That's when Mya looks up from the movie and runs over to them, wanting to investigate what all of this commotion is about.

"Want to feel the baby, Mya?" Andy asks with a smile.

Mya grins and rapidly nods her head. Sam picks her up and places her on his lap, so she can reach Andy's stomach. Then, Andy takes her tiny hand and places it on her belly.

The baby kicks just seconds later, eliciting several giggles from the little girl.

"That's your baby sister," Andy tells her.

"Is she trying to get out of your belly?" Mya wonders, eliciting a chuckle from both adults.

"No sweetie, she's just saying hello," Andy tells her. "She's so excited to meet you," Andy adds.

"When is she gonna come out of there?" Mya asks, looking down at Andy's stomach. She's been rather fascinated by Andy's belly ever since she found out there was a baby inside. Sometimes when they are lying in bed reading bedtime stories or just hanging out on the couch, Mya decides to have conversations with her baby sister. And it's pretty much the sweetest thing Andy's ever seen. The other day, Mya spent a good five minutes telling the baby all kinds of adorable things- that she could share Mya's toys, that she could pick the bedtime stories, that they would have sleepovers in her room, that Mya would push her on the swings, that they'd play hide and seek together, and that they would be best friends. And yeah, with all of these hormones flowing through Andy nowadays, it took just about everything in her not to cry. But then of course, when Sam got home after shift and Andy told him all about it, she failed miserably at containing the tears.

"Not for a couple more months. She's not done cooking yet," Andy tells her with a smile.

"She's cooking?" Mya asks with a horrified look on her face.

"She's not done growing," Sam amends before giving his daughter a kiss on her temple.

"Oh," Mya says with a nod.

"Are you excited to be a big sister?" Andy asks. Andy knows she is, but she just likes to hear her say it.

"Yeah," Mya says as Sam pushes some hair out of her face. "Is the baby gonna like me?" Mya wonders.

"She's gonna love you, sweetheart," Andy assures her with a smile as she glances over at her husband beaming at his daughter.

Mya smiles at Andy and then leans in to give her belly a kiss just like she's seen Sam on more than one occasion. "Love you," she says as she pulls away from Andy's stomach.

And yeah, Andy is already tearing up at the sweet gesture. Then, she quickly exchanges a glance with Sam, who has this look on his face that is a mixture of complete adoration at his daughter and a playful smirk at his wife, who is desperately trying not to get emotional. He gives Mya another kiss on the temple and rubs circles along Andy's back.

And then, Mya suddenly remembers that she was watching a movie and quickly wiggles off of Sam's lap and gets back to her spot on the rug. "Daddy! Go back!" she exclaims as she impatiently looks back at her father.

Sam lets out a laugh, grabs the remote and rewinds the movie to the perfect spot. Then, he gets his arm around his wife, pulls her close and places a couple kisses on her head.

"Seriously- can you believe she just did that? It's like she's trying to make me cry," Andy whines as her eyes start to water a bit.

"I know… she's diabolical," he mocks, as he wipes a stray tear from under Andy's eyes as she rolls them at him.
